The simplest form of 36 / 6 is 6 / 1. Steps to simplifying fractions. Find the GCD (or HCF) of numerator and denominator GCD of 36 and 6 is 6; Divide both the numerator and denominator by the GCD 36 ÷ 6 / 6 ÷ 6; Reduced fraction: 6 / 1 Therefore, 36/6 simplified to lowest terms is 6/1. Let's set up 4/6 and 1/6 side by side so they are easier to see: 4 6 x 1 6. The next step is to multiply the numerators on the top line and the denominators on the bottom line: 4 x 1 6 x 6. From there, we can perform the multiplication to get the resulting fraction: 4 x 1 6 x 6 = 4 36. You're done! You now know exactly how to calculate 4/6 x 1/6. Learn how to calculate 1/6 times 2/3.
